President's XI of LI lift NYTBCL Summer 2020 T15 Trophy

 
  • Final: Spartans 71/8; President's XI of LI 72/8 (14.4 overs)
  • Semi Final 1: President's XI of LI 68/7 (15 overs); KKNY 57/9
  • Semi Final 2: Spartans 90/9; President's XI of Tri-State 85/9
 

Vijay Kapoor, Captain of President’s XI of LI collecting the trophy along with team members
 
NEW YORK: President’s XI of LI (PXI) held their nerve for the second time in a row and pulled off a thrilling two-wicket win, beating Spartans in finals of New York Tennis Ball Cricket League (NYTBCL) Summer 2020 T15 tournament held at Eisenhower Park in East Meadow, NY on Sunday, September 6th, 2020. Earlier in the semi-finals, PXI beat KKNY in a low scoring thriller!
 
On a windy day, Vijay Kapoor, Captain of PXI won the toss and elected to bowl. Spartans lost Mitesh Patel 2(4) early as Dhwanil Shah disturbed the timber in second over. Dhwanil was at it again when he got Spartans captain Dilip Reddy 4(8), caught by Bhavin Maniar with score at 20/2 in 4 overs. Spartans needed some stability and Shridhar Singamshetty 20(26) tried his best to rotate the strike against tidy bowling by PXI. Shridhar was eventually run out going for a nonexistent single.
 
With Spartans requiring to change gears, Vishal Gaur 11(10) joined Madhur Katyal 16(18) in the middle and the duo put on together 23 run partnership for the 7th wicket taking the score to a respectable 71/8 in 15 overs. For PXI, Mustafa Moiz (3-0-12-2), Dhwanil Shah (3-0-12-2) and Biren Dhulia (3-0-17-2) were the pick of the bowlers.
 
In the chase, PXI got off to a good start with two openers Vijay Kapoor 12(11) and Bhavin Maniar 17(22)
Putting together 26 in 4 overs. However, Appa Vade of Spartans had other plans. He bowled excellent over taking out Vijay Kapoor caught and then disturbing timber of tournament highest run scorer Rajiv Nair 0(2). It was downhill for PXI for next 8 overs as they slipped from comfortable 26/0 in 4 overs to 52/8 by end of 12 overs. The game seemed to be heading in Spartan’s way.
 
That’s when the cool heads of Mustafa Moiz 19(23) and Raj Kumar 6(10) put on an unbeaten partnership of 20 runs, which ultimately won the cup for PXI. They waited for the loose deliveries and defended the good ones. This match will be remembered for a crucial 5-wide bowled at the penultimate over, which sealed the match PXI’s way. For Spartans, Appa Vade (3-0-15-3), Vamshi Lavang (3-0-11-2) and Vishal Gaur (2.4-0-9-2) bowled excellent spells. Mustafa Moiz was adjudged the Man of the match.
 
The entire PXI team and support staff ran on to the field when the winning runs were hit. The jubilation and celebration were very much evident. This was the first championship win for PXI, a closely knit team born just 1 year ago on the aspirations of Suresh Konappanavar and Manoj Samuel, funded and supported by Dr Aman Deep.
